Intergovernmental Relations: The Dynamic Reality of American Federalism.
Liebschutz, Sarah F.
Update on Law-Related Education, v19 n3 p15-16 Fall 1995
Maintains that intergovernmental relations are dynamic because local, state, and federal governments constantly respond to changing expectations. This interdependent relationship requires the various governments to modify their pursuit of special interests through daily bargaining. This process affects every aspect of government. (MJP)
